What do I do if a conflict arises in my fantasy football league?
If conflict arises, you go to the commissioner. Maybe you could try to settle the conflict in the fantasy football league between two owners, but at the point where it's acutally a conflict, as maybe two people are arguing over who should have picked up a certian player, that they weren't given a true chance to get a player, or they don't understand the rules and it wasn't fair, you go to the commissioner and he will settle any dispute. Another dispute that can come up is if there is a trade that not everyone in the fantasy football league agrees with. You don't want to dispute a trade just because you think it helps a team that you're competing with, I usually allow most trades, or I say give the guy a break as if it's a bad trade, it's just a bad trade. But usually, you're just looking for fairness as it's really obvious if something is unfair. For example if someone is taking the best player in the fantasy football league, and he's trading him for a random wide receiver, that's obviously unfair as there's something not okay about that. And that's where a commissioner steps into the dispute and doesn't allow it. But if someone is trading the best player for another one of the best running backs, you have to allow that trade because it's fair and it's reasonable. Maybe you don't think its a good trade, but it's fair.
